Высокая доступность Keepalived

Средний

Изучите высокую доступность Keepalived. Этот модуль охватывает концепции VRRP и установку, настройку основного узла (Master Node), настройку резервного узла (Backup Node), тестирование переключения (Failover), переключение с учетом состояния служб (Service-Aware Failover). Вы освоите эти важные навыки Linux с помощью практических лабораторных работ и реальных задач.

devops-engineeransibledevopslinux

💡 Этот учебник переведен с английского с помощью ИИ. Чтобы просмотреть оригинал, вы можете перейти на английский оригинал

Обеспечение высокой доступности с помощью Keepalived

Узнайте, как Keepalived использует протокол VRRP для обеспечения отказоустойчивости критически важных сервисов за счет использования мастер-узлов и резервных узлов, тестирования переключения при сбоях и логики проверки работоспособности сервисов. Этот курс знакомит с концепциями высокой доступности в Linux, необходимыми для устранения единых точек отказа на уровне сетевого входа.

Почему это важно

Балансировка нагрузки улучшает распределение трафика, но не решает проблему выхода из строя самого балансировщика. Keepalived помогает администраторам настроить плавающий виртуальный IP-адрес (VIP) и автоматическое переключение между узлами, что является фундаментальным элементом для создания высокодоступных сервисов в Linux. Понимание этой модели необходимо, когда системе требуется непрерывность работы, выходящая за рамки одного хоста.

Чему вы научитесь

  • Понимать концепции VRRP и принципы обеспечения отказоустойчивости с помощью Keepalived.
  • Настраивать мастер-узел для пары высокодоступных сервисов.
  • Настраивать резервный узел, готовый взять на себя нагрузку в случае необходимости.
  • Тестировать процесс переключения при сбоях, а не просто полагаться на корректность конфигурации.
  • Использовать проверки работоспособности сервисов, чтобы решения о переключении основывались на реальном состоянии приложения.
  • Применять полученные знания в практическом задании по созданию высокодоступного веб-сервиса.

План курса

Курс начинается с изучения концепций VRRP и установки Keepalived, чтобы вы могли понять модель отказоустойчивости перед переходом к настройке. Затем мы перейдем к конфигурации мастер-узла и резервного узла, который будет готов принять на себя виртуальный IP-адрес.

Далее основное внимание уделяется тестированию переключения, что позволит вам проверить поведение системы в контролируемых условиях. После этого вы добавите логику проверки работоспособности сервисов, чтобы статус узла отражал не только состояние хоста, но и доступность конкретного приложения.

Курс завершается практическим заданием по созданию высокодоступного веб-сервиса, где управление виртуальным IP, настройка ролей, мониторинг состояния и проверка отказоустойчивости объединяются в реалистичном сценарии, ориентированном на обеспечение непрерывности работы.

Для кого этот курс

Этот курс предназначен для тех, кто изучает Linux, и специалистов по инфраструктуре, которые хотят понять, как реализуется отказоустойчивость в традиционных стеках сервисов Linux.

Результаты обучения

По окончании курса вы сможете описывать процесс переключения на основе VRRP, настраивать мастер-узлы и резервные узлы Keepalived, проверять корректность перехвата нагрузки и более глубоко понимать принципы обеспечения непрерывности сервисов за пределами одного сервера.

Преподаватель

labby
Labby
Labby is the LabEx teacher.